您的位置:軟件測試 > 軟件項目管理 > 項目計劃 >
如何在需求不斷變化的項目中取得成功
作者:網(wǎng)絡(luò)轉(zhuǎn)載 發(fā)布時間:[ 2013/6/13 14:23:23 ] 推薦標(biāo)簽:

在中國軟件行業(yè)現(xiàn)狀中,惡性競爭比比皆是,而惡性競爭的產(chǎn)生物:合同,導(dǎo)致大中型軟件項目中,項目組面臨著在時間上,成本上和人力上都不切實際的目標(biāo),一個在標(biāo)準(zhǔn)含義上注定要失敗的項目;而項目組對于這種項目要做,并且還要盡量做好,同時由于客戶成熟度不夠,而造成更多的問題。
根據(jù)個人的經(jīng)驗,如果照合同中列出的項目范圍來做,從狹義的項目范圍角度來說是可以完成的,但客戶既然付了錢,他將不斷努力大化他的利益,擴充并充實需求的內(nèi)容,所以項目組面臨著項目中從始至終需求不斷變化的過程。
在做好基本的需求控制的基礎(chǔ)上,既然面對不斷變化的需求,要求項目組對事件的反應(yīng)要快。
在這種快節(jié)奏的項目環(huán)境中,充滿了太多的不確定因素,成功的按時完成項目像是一場長距離障礙跑。項目組經(jīng)常要在沒有完整確切的數(shù)據(jù)情況下決定如何做,項目范圍的重點和方向要經(jīng)常改變,如果軟件承包商內(nèi)部不協(xié)調(diào)一致,復(fù)雜的項目將經(jīng)常會陷入泥潭,不能自拔。
這種項目中標(biāo)準(zhǔn)的項目管理手段不再適用,它需要很多特別的資源去處理不確定的方面,更有彈性的項目管理手段和反應(yīng)時間是必要的,靈活的項目管理手段將是此類項目的終方法。
什么是靈活的項目管理
做過軟件項目管理的項目經(jīng)理的人都知道,在客戶的需求和項目組能夠提交的成果之間找到一個完美的平衡點不僅僅是一種項目管理手段,而是一種藝術(shù),如果按照標(biāo)準(zhǔn)的項目管理流程,項目可能永遠(yuǎn)不會完成,比如在合同中或銷售環(huán)節(jié)中承諾,所提供的系統(tǒng)將滿足客戶在未來幾年中的業(yè)務(wù)需求;但實際上這是不可能的,特別是行業(yè)軟件項目,中國各個行業(yè)處于快速發(fā)展的過程中,業(yè)務(wù)需求不斷在增加,如果不在項目和業(yè)務(wù)需求之間達(dá)到平衡,項目將不再是一個利潤點,而是一個成本點。這要求在標(biāo)準(zhǔn)的項目管理手段之外增加一些新的概念和技巧來適應(yīng)飛速變化的項目環(huán)境。
那什么是靈活的項目管理呢?
由于在實際項目的某些方面,標(biāo)準(zhǔn)項目管理方法不再具備有效性和可操作性,所以有些公司試圖拋開項目管理標(biāo)準(zhǔn)方法,獨立制定符合自己實際的項目管理流程,而在不斷嘗試的過程中,他們在很多核心管理方面又不得不遵循標(biāo)準(zhǔn)項目管理手段,這造成了困擾,什么是一種有效而可行的項目管理方法?
所以說,靈活的項目管理不是一種獨立的項目管理模式,而是基于標(biāo)準(zhǔn)項目管理基礎(chǔ)上的一種很大的發(fā)展延伸。像一個城市的地鐵站臺,她的基礎(chǔ)是標(biāo)準(zhǔn)的,牢固地,像標(biāo)準(zhǔn)項目管理,而站臺和所運行的地鐵之間的差距需要根據(jù)地鐵的實際形狀來加以適當(dāng)?shù)难由,所以說靈活的項目管理歸根結(jié)底是在標(biāo)準(zhǔn)項目管理的基礎(chǔ)上的延伸。
計劃和實施
當(dāng)我們談到項目管理的時候,我們直接的印象是工作列表和甘特圖,或者叫工作時間表或安排,從標(biāo)準(zhǔn)項目管理理論來講,項目計劃是重點,要占項目周期的很大一部分,首先要制定一整套項目計劃,包括項目范圍計劃、項目進度管理計劃、項目質(zhì)量管理計劃、項目人力管理計劃、項目成本管理計劃、項目風(fēng)險管理計劃、項目溝通管理計劃、項目配置管理計劃、項目變更管理計劃等等。而在現(xiàn)實情況下,客戶決不允許你在計劃階段花費太多時間,實際上,客戶希望看到項目組到現(xiàn)場馬上進入編程開發(fā),他才覺得項目組在做事情,不然開發(fā)商是在浪費他們的精力和資金;如果項目經(jīng)理頂住客戶的壓力,嚴(yán)格按照標(biāo)準(zhǔn)項目管理流程,將得罪客戶,為以后的工作添置很多障礙,有些是致命的。
應(yīng)用靈活的項目管理,項目管理的重點從計劃轉(zhuǎn)移到實施,但不是說項目的范圍定義和計劃被完全忽略,而是在不完整的需求確認(rèn)和項目總體計劃框架下進入實際開發(fā),在需求不斷變化和項目目標(biāo)漸進明細(xì)的情況下靈活的把握項目,將項目始終處于控制范圍內(nèi)。
而且,對于行業(yè)軟件開發(fā)而言,隨著業(yè)務(wù)的變化發(fā)展,業(yè)務(wù)需求和功能需求的不斷變更,要求有豐富業(yè)務(wù)和技術(shù)水平的獨特專家在項目組中,這些專家不僅僅簡單的認(rèn)為是高級程序員,也不是系統(tǒng)設(shè)計人員。具體來說他們是一組人,一組在這個行業(yè)摸爬滾打中練一身過硬業(yè)務(wù)知識和技術(shù)水平的人員。他們對于行業(yè)軟件這個大的系統(tǒng)里的不同部分具有很多比客戶還要深刻的理解和認(rèn)識,在同一個行業(yè)軟件領(lǐng)域中,比如針對中小型商業(yè)銀行的銀行軟件解決方案,大多數(shù)項目在功能上,業(yè)務(wù)需求上等等方面都有著某些方面的類似性和相同性,在一個新的項目中,這組人不管是在簡單或復(fù)雜的項目計劃情況下都有能力和水平將項目中所有的部分組和在一起,像事先經(jīng)過了詳細(xì)的系統(tǒng)設(shè)計一般。
在這種情況下,項目經(jīng)理面臨著一個挑戰(zhàn),項目艱難而有效的實施下去將是項目所能達(dá)到的好效果;面對太多太快的變化導(dǎo)致項目經(jīng)理手忙腳亂,不知所措將是項目經(jīng)理所要經(jīng)歷的壞局面,如果不及時將項目重新納入正軌,項目將是一場災(zāi)難。行業(yè)軟件這個領(lǐng)域而言,不要希望這些項目你不會遇到,在現(xiàn)實世界中,你要做好準(zhǔn)備,經(jīng)常性面對這種項目。
靈活的項目管理特點: 內(nèi)部和外部不確定因素
內(nèi)部和外部不確定因素是靈活的項目管理的重點所在,眾多的不確定因素導(dǎo)致項目總是處于緊急和高風(fēng)險的狀態(tài)下,這要求項目經(jīng)理和項目組的獨特才能和技術(shù)。
內(nèi)部不確定因素包括那些在項目經(jīng)理可控制的項目范圍內(nèi),進度安排內(nèi)和預(yù)算成本內(nèi)所有的內(nèi)部可控或不可控的方面。例如:對于數(shù)據(jù)倉庫項目,針對客戶在系統(tǒng)某些功能執(zhí)行時間上的苛刻要求,在1G的數(shù)據(jù)量以下,系統(tǒng)可以滿足要求,但隨著可以預(yù)見數(shù)據(jù)量的飛速增加,在一段時間后,系統(tǒng)將不得不面對1G以上的數(shù)據(jù)處理量,而解決此問題的途徑有幾種,不論是在項目中解決該問題,還是在維護期解決該問題,項目經(jīng)理一定要從項目的各個方面進行權(quán)衡,快速找到一個恰當(dāng)?shù)姆桨浮?br /> 外部不確定因素包括不在項目原始范圍內(nèi),比如行業(yè)發(fā)展和競爭需求中所產(chǎn)生的新要求,例如:一個城市商業(yè)銀行一攬子解決方案的項目,包括核心業(yè)務(wù)系統(tǒng)、信貸管理系統(tǒng)、國際業(yè)務(wù)系統(tǒng)、中間業(yè)務(wù)系統(tǒng)等等,項目經(jīng)理和項目組業(yè)已將客戶的需求控制在一定范圍內(nèi),信貸項目組根據(jù)以往的經(jīng)驗,預(yù)見到在綜合業(yè)務(wù)系統(tǒng)上線后不久客戶將會提出現(xiàn)場信貸功能的需求,但按照現(xiàn)有銀行模式,所有數(shù)據(jù)是大集中在中央數(shù)據(jù)庫中,如果現(xiàn)場信貸的功能要實現(xiàn),那不得不要求核心業(yè)務(wù)系統(tǒng)提供數(shù)據(jù)源和數(shù)據(jù)端口,而由于此項功能需求是行業(yè)中發(fā)展中一項新的功能亮點,現(xiàn)在的核心業(yè)務(wù)系統(tǒng)不包括此接口,而要增加此功能端口和源要求核心業(yè)務(wù)系統(tǒng)要做很多改動,有些是重大改動,如果放在二期來做,客觀條件不允許在具有生產(chǎn)數(shù)據(jù)下進行長時間充分的測試,很可能造成系統(tǒng)的不穩(wěn)定,而銀行系統(tǒng)又需要具備很強的穩(wěn)定性,還有可能造成銀行在結(jié)算、沖賬這些關(guān)鍵環(huán)節(jié)上的錯誤,這個時候項目經(jīng)理面對的是外部不確定因素。
這兩個方面都是靈活的項目管理方法中必須要考慮的因素,項目經(jīng)理不得不決定到底如何要解決它們。
對于內(nèi)部不確定因素,它的風(fēng)險性對于第一次做此類項目的項目經(jīng)理是高的,隨著項目經(jīng)理經(jīng)驗的增加,它的風(fēng)險性呈現(xiàn)反比例發(fā)展。像世間無一樣,風(fēng)險不可能減小到零,所以,無論你作為項目經(jīng)理和你的團隊做過多少個同類型的項目,也不論之前成功實施的幾個項目間和新項目有多么的類似性,永遠(yuǎn)不要期望項目完全按照你的既定計劃來走,沒有人會知道會有什么樣的事情會在項目中等著你,每一個項目都在考驗?zāi)愕捻椖抗芾砟芰挽`活的項目管理手段。

上一頁12下一頁
軟件測試工具 | 聯(lián)系我們 | 投訴建議 | 誠聘英才 | 申請使用列表 | 網(wǎng)站地圖
滬ICP備07036474 2003-2017 版權(quán)所有 上海澤眾軟件科技有限公司 Shanghai ZeZhong Software Co.,Ltd